Introduction

The field of production encompasses the processes, technologies, and managerial practices involved in creating goods and organizing industrial workflows. It plays a crucial role in ensuring efficiency and effectiveness in various sectors, from manufacturing to film production. Russian universities have recognized the importance of this field and now offer a myriad of programs focusing on engineering, management, film, food processing, and technological printing.

Key Areas of Study in Production

Engineering, Manufacturing, and Production

One of the cornerstone areas of production studies in Russia is engineering and manufacturing. Russian universities provide a range of master’s and undergraduate programs that emphasize both technical skills and managerial acumen.

  • Program Structure:
    • Production Management
    • Process Optimization
    • Innovation in Manufacturing
  • Career Pathways: Graduates are well-equipped for roles in industrial enterprises, research organizations, and international markets.

Food Production

Food production studies in Russia are spearheaded by institutions like the Moscow State University of Food Production, which is recognized as a major scientific center.

  • Specialization: Focuses on both theoretical knowledge and practical applications in food sciences.
  • Career Readiness: Graduates are prepared to enter the food production sector.
